    When I'm on the phone, I cannot get the hardware volume buttons to change the level I'm hearing. This issue is the same whether on handset, headset or bluetooth buds. Volume does work for things like (annoyingly) overriding custom alerts, and listening to audio books. So the buttons do work.

    Is it a bug or a setting I've not discovered?

    Found the Solution.
    If you go into the Settings/System/AboutPhone you will find Build number at the bottom. If you tap on that 7 times you will get developer status. A new menu item in the System menu (one level up) will pop up called Developer. In there you can override the max sound volume settings. Problem solved.
